Why it's worth checking out
Chautari brings Nepali food and hospitality to Aralia Street in Nightcliff, with a dining concept centred on gathering, sharing and connection. The restaurant takes its name from the traditional chautari: a stone resting platform beneath a banyan or peepal tree where travellers would pause, talk and eat together. That idea carries through the venue’s stated approach, which is to create a welcoming place for friends and families to share meals and moments in a setting that feels familiar and comfortable.
The food is presented as a link between Nepal’s street and village culture and contemporary tastes. The clearest example is Gilo Chatpate, a lively street-food snack described as a mix of puffed rice, crunchy noodles, fresh herbs and tangy spices, finished with lemon and chilli. Its flavour profile brings together sour, spicy and richly spiced notes, while the dish is mixed just before serving so it stays fresh. Chautari connects it with the everyday food culture of Kathmandu and Pokhara, as well as the experience of sharing a snack and conversation beneath the shade of a chautari.
